2021 Korean Cultural Center in Poland "Digital Korean Culture and Art Workshop"


Every Saturday from October 16th to 30th, the 'Digital Korean Culture and Art Workshop' is held at the Korean Cultural Center in Poland.

Proceed. We hope that many of you who are interested in Korean traditional culture and digital art will participate.
